Photography Lighting - Everything You Need To Know - NFI

    https://www.nfi.edu/photography-lighting/
    Short Lighting in Photography. Short lighting is almost the polar opposite of broad lighting. In this scenario, the side nearest the camera is in shadow, while the far side is lit. Instead of generating a more extensive shape, short lighting thins it out, so be careful how and when you employ both strategies. Video: Short Lighting in Photography

Photography Lighting: Setup, Techniques, and Tips

    https://motionarray.com/learn/photography/photography-lighting/
    Learning these photography lighting basics is a great foundation for other setups. The 3-Point Lighting Setup. The 3-point lighting setup needs three lights, or two lights, and a reflector or bounce card. The idea is that the 3 light sources work in conjunction to produce an evenly lit subject and a background that has depth. The key light is your main light, it will be the …

The Five Basic Portrait-Lighting Setups - Gene Sasse

    https://genesasse.com/photo/pdfs/lighting-tips/Five_Basic_Portrait.pdf
    Lighting patterns change as the key light is moved from close to and high above the subject to the side of the subject and lower. The key light should not be positioned below eye level, as lighting from beneath does not occur in nature.
